The postcode HG3 5HL is located in Harrogate, in the county of North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. HG3 5HL is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

HG3 5HL is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of HG3 5HL as Rural residents > Rural tenants > Rural white-collar workers.

The closest road name to HG3 5HL is Low Wath Road which is centered 491 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Upper Nidd High School and is 86 m away.

The closest primary school to HG3 5HL (for ages 11 and under) is St Cuthbert's Church of England Primary School, Pateley Bridge.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 3, 2017.

The local pub for residents of HG3 5HL is Craven Arms and is 11.46 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Satisfactory on February 7,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 46.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 10.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 2%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 98%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for HG3 5HL is covered by the North Yorkshire police force association and North Yorkshire and York is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
